Every 10 seconds, Samaritans responds to a call for help. We're staying silent for 10 hours to raise money for them.
I've been a Samaritan for the last year, and I've been inspired by the volunteers who work so hard to make sure there is always someone there for our callers. I want to raise money to help this effort continue.
If you know me, you'll know that silence is not one of my strengths - in fact, becoming a listening volunteer for the Samaritans meant I have really had to work at building in more silence when I am on those calls! This 10 hours will really test me, and I hope you'll give generously to help me get through the day!
We commit to silence from 7am till 5pm, and we hope to be set up in Tunbridge Wells for the day collecting donations and raising awareness, pending council approval.
Around 6000 people a year in the UK die by suicide. The Samaritans are working to reduce this number. Lets try to help them continue this important work.
